                              Have the media twisted what he said because this was posted on rawk last night and was translated by a Uruguayan

                              Full audio of the press conference:
                              http://www.seleccionuruguayadefutbol...rencia-de.html

                              Some notes:
                              - he states that the papparazzi have been chasing his daughter and wife into the kindergarten
                              - he repeatedly states that he loves the city of Liverpool, the club, and the fans
                              - the "no one defended me" quote is about journalists, not the club or fans
                              - he hasn't decided to move abroad, but if harassment of his family continues, then he knows what to choose
                              - there is nothing discussed with Real Madrid or other clubs
                              - Suarez was annoyed with Uruguayan media for constantly asking him about this rather than the games against France and Venezuela (it was clear that our media wants him in Spain)
                              - he doesn't exactly think highly of David Cameron, and says that the PM has better things to do
                              - he never thought that he could win the Player of the Year awards, with the UK media so against him. Even so, some players (here he mentions Gerrard) decided to openly back him
                              - he says, several times, that the Ivanovic incident was his **** up
